**About the Group**

**Public Spending Group**

The Public Spending Group is a high-profile and rewarding place to work. We help the Chancellor decide what to spend £1.2 trillion a year on and ensure government delivers value for money for the taxpayer. We are responsible for reporting to Parliament and the public on how taxpayers’ money is spent. We drive forward improved outcomes and efficiency in public services and make sure value for money is at the centre of decision-making through better evaluation, data and analysis.

We advise on overall government policy on public sector pay and pensions, the biggest single driver of public spending. We collaborate with and directly support departments to deliver the Government Finance Function strategy, building finance, debt and risk capability across government and developing the management information, tools and frameworks to better understand and ensure value for money.

**About the Team**

**General Expenditure Policy (GEP)**

GEP sits at the heart of HM Treasury's Public Spending Group. We are a friendly and inclusive team, responsible for reporting to the Chancellor and Chief Secretary on spending control. We work closely with Strategy Planning and Budget Group, the Fiscal Strategy Group, spending teams and No.10 to manage risks and ensure Ministers have advice on future public spending strategy and on options for funding new priorities, both at fiscal events and as they arise throughout the year. We also work with other government departments to monitor the real-world impact of spending, to ensure that outcomes for citizens are placed at the core of decision making. The team is also the custodian of the Green Book and Major Project appraisal.

**About the Job**

This is a central and fast-paced role within GEP’s Capital Unit. You will be at the heart of the Budget and spending review when spending choices are critical to the government’s macroeconomic and fiscal strategy, advising ministers on the impact of decisions on the country’s infrastructure. You will have opportunities to influence a wide variety of policy areas, gain insight into the fiscal policy decision-making process, and have significant exposure to senior officials and ministers.

You will lead the branch in the Capital Spending Unit responsible for analysis and allocation of multi-year capital budgets across government in the Spending Review (over £115bn per year) from economic and social infrastructure to R&D. You will help shape the spending strategy and trade-offs across ministerial priorities e.g. energy security and net zero, Defence, hospitals, schools. The role would suit an official who is able to blend strong analytical capabilities with strategic thinking and/or an analyst with experience of spending policy.

Responsibilities include:

- Leading HM Treasury’s capital analysis for fiscal events and the spending review. Be responsible for the capital spending model and ensure it is analytically sound.
